STRING OF HEARTS
The String of Hearts is a vining succulent. They are easy care as long as you remember that they are a succulent, and their vines can reach up to 3 metres.
WATER
Your String of Hearts is susceptible to root rot if overwatered. Allow the pot to dry out completely between waterings and consider bottom watering in the colder months.
LIGHT
String of Hearts like lots and lots of light. Somewhere that receives morning or late afternoon direct light is perfect. Be careful of too much midday direct light though as this will scorch the leaves.
FERTILISING
Feed once a month in the Spring and Summer months.
SOIL
The ideal soil mix for a String of Hearts is a mix designed for Cacti. You can achieve this by adding lots of sand, Pumice and perlite to a standard houseplant mix.
TEMPERATURE
String of Hearts like to be warm. Most household temperatures are fine but keep away from draughty windows.
HUMIDITY
As they are succulents they are not a particular fan of humidity.
TOXICITY
Considered non toxic to humans and animals.
